An Art oasis in the midst of the crumbling nostalgic charm of Havana. Fabrica is nestled in an old Factory (Fabrica) and with the addition of Shipping Containers has become, an Art Museum, Concert Hall, Bar (5 or 6 of them), Dance Club, and all around place to hang. We were allowed into the VIP Section which provided us an open-air section nestled between shipping containers, waitress service (to keep the drinks flowing) and of course, a smoking section. Fabrica was refreshingly raw as we wondered within its belly. In many places where, we'd be "nannied" in the US with a "do not enter" sign due to stairs too steep or areas easy to fall from, it was no so here. Habana Mike Posted November 26, 2016 Posted November 26, 2016 One awesome thing about it is it's relatively inexpensive, to the point even some number of Cubans can enjoy it, at least those with a sideline or two. Couple CUC entry, 2-3CUC drinks. Fantastic experience. Nightclub, art gallery, music venue, anything and everything! 1
